FROZEN SOUL live up to their name as the sound of death metal at its most cold and classic. Their new album Crypt of Ice is out now via Century Media.

The band just premiered the NSFW video for album track “Arctic Stranglehold.”

“‘Arctic Stranglehold’ is our favorite song off of Crypt of Ice,” the band says. “We started out doing just a visual, non-performance video for it, but in the end, we thought that it deserved a lot more to really show the song. We went back to the drawing board with Tanner McCardle and our good friend Dave Gonzalez with Metal Dave Media and decided to shoot some DIY scenes ourselves to add into what Tanner had already done! All the performance scenes and death scenes were shot in our jam space, then Tanner filmed some additional footage to add to that.”

The band finishes, “After we got all of the new additions finished, Tanner reworked the original visuals that he filmed and edited it together with all the new footage. ‘Arctic Stranglehold’ came to life, or death!! We put a lot of hard work into this video and are stoked for everyone to see it! COLD SCHOOL DEATH METAL FOREVER.”

ABOUT FROZEN SOUL:
FROZEN SOUL’s brand of straightforward, in-your-face death metal is a gasp of fresh air in a genre that’s stretched the very limits of technicality. Fully formed in 2018, the quintet has rapidly made a name for itself and churned the underground with a sound that evokes the old school sound of bands like Obituary, Mortician, and Bolt Thrower. That reverence for death metal’s roots was apparent from Frozen Soul’s initial four-song Encased in Ice demo, which includes a cover of Mortician’s “Witch’s Coven” and was released in early 2019 on California’s Maggot Stomp Records. 

FROZEN SOUL entered the studio in early March 2020 to record its first full-length with former guitarist Daniel Schmuck handling production and mixing duties. Crypt of Ice is nothing short of a breath of very fresh and very cold air on death metal’s fiery landscape. From re-recorded demo tracks including the call-to-arms of “Encased in Ice” and the savage frost blister of “Wraith of Death” to the brutal, pummeling, and momentous guitar churn of “Arctic Stranglehold,” FROZEN SOUL have delivered a record that embraces the genre’s past while pushing death metal forward with frigid force.
